
Instance#1:
Evan meets God but doesn't know who He is just yet. And when Evan asks Him, "Do I know you?" God responds, "Not as well as I'd like"
Instance#2:
Evan, frustrated with all of the things being asked of him (the least of which is the building of an ark) asks God why He's doing all this to him (Evan). God responds, "Because I love you."
Instance#3:
God is explaining to Evan's wife about how God answers prayers, and says (rough transcript): "If you pray for patience, does God make you patient, or does He give you opportunities to be patient? If you pray for courage, does God make you brave, or does He give you an opportunity to be courageous? And if you pray for your family to be closer, does He make you feel all fuzzy inside, or does He give you the chance to stand beside each other?"
